Wenger: Arsenal require ‘special resilience’ to catch Chelsea

Arsene Wenger admits Arsenal will need something special to catch Premier League leaders Chelsea.

The Gunners defeated West Bromwich Albion 1-0 on Boxing Day to bounce back from two straight losses.

The result means the North Londoners are still nine points behind their local rivals after 18 matches but there is still hope in the title race if Arsenal can continue to show a strong resilience, according to Wenger.

Asked if Arsenal have a stronger backbone this season, Wenger said: "Maybe, yes.

"I feel yes because it's normal that I tell you yes, but we have to show that for the whole season to maintain that kind of resilience you know.

"At the moment there is quite a big distance between us and Chelsea and we need a special resilience to come back, but I hope that the other teams will have as well their moments of weakness and we can only take advantage of it if we continue like that."
